PURPOSE:To enable exact data acquisition even with the change of heart beat period by detecting each of a living body image data and heart movement, and preserving the heart movement data at the time of image data detection together with the elapsed time information from the reference time phase. CONSTITUTION:A living body image data from a cancer camera is temporarily stored in either of input buffers 2 or 3 by way of a switching circuit 1. Out of the electrocardiowave signals of an electrocardiograph an R wave is detected 5 and for every detection signal the circuit 1 is switched by turns. And the switching circuit 4 on the output side of the buffers 2 and 3 is switched by turns in the opposite phase to it. By this detection signal, the elapsed time information from the reference time phase is also added 10 to the image data simultaneously. These are read in this manner from the buffer where no data is stored and the image data are distributed to image memories 81 to 8n based on the elapsed time information by a distributing circuit 6 and also stored in a memory device 9. Thus, the quality and measurement accuracy of the restructured images are raised by the data synchronized with the heart movement. |
